Choosing Between Mounjaro and copyright for Weight Loss
Embarking on a weight loss journey can be daunting, but groundbreaking injections like Mounjaro and copyright offer promising solutions. Both drugs, while mainly used to manage type 2 diabetes, have proven effective in substantially reducing excess pounds. However, understanding their variations is crucial to determine which option aligns with your individual needs and goals.
Mounjaro, also known by its generic name tirzepatide, targets multiple hormones involved in appetite regulation and blood sugar control. copyright, or semaglutide, focuses on mimicking a hormone that suppresses appetite. This distinction leads to likely variations in side effects and overall experience.
